Acute Pancreatitis due to Hydrochlorthiazide and Lisinopril
Hungarian Medical Journal, 2008An elderly man with a longstanding history of hypertension on hydrochlorthiazide 25 mg and enalapril 5 mg once daily for the last seven years, presented with acute abdominal pain and diagnosed to have acute pancreatitis. Other causes of the disease were ruled out.

Photochemical interaction between triamterene and hydrochlorthiazide
International Journal of Pharmaceutics, 1991Abstract Flash photolysis and steady-state photosensitized oxidation experiments have been used to show that there is an interaction or cross-sensitization between the diuretic drugs, triamterene and hydrochlorthiazide, when irradiated with UV light in the same solution.

A comparison of the antihypertensive effect of chlorthalidone and hydrochlorthiazide
Clinical Pharmacology & Therapeutics, 1964Chlorthalidone, hydrochlorthiazide, and a placebo were compared in a double‐blind study. Both drugs used in this study were effective antihypertensive agents and produced similar electrolyte changes.

Diuretic Response to Hydrochlorthiazide in Rheumatoid Arthritis
Acta Rheumatologica Scandinavica, 1962SummaryA series of 20 patients with rheumatoid arthritis and an equal number of controls were studied with regard to the diuretic action of hydrochlorthiazide. Simultaneous LC Determination of Chlorogenic Acid and Hydrochlorthiazide in Zhenju Jiangya Tablets
Chromatographia, 2006A method has been developed to determine chlorogenic acid and hydrochlorothiazide simultaneously in Zhenju Jiangya tablets by HPLC using an isocratic mode and UV detection. A solution of acetonitrile-0.4% phosphoric acid (13:87, v/v) was used as mobile phase. Results showed that the two compounds were well separated.

Effect of pindolol on changes in serum lipids induced by hydrochlorthiazide
European Journal of Clinical Pharmacology, 1989Forty-two patients with essential hypertension, WHO I-II, and a diastolic blood pressure greater than or equal to 100 mm Hg, were initially given 25 mg hydrochlorthiazide alone. After treatment for 3 months 10 mg pindolol was also given to 16 of them as the diastolic blood pressure had not been reduced to less than or equal to 90 mm Hg.
